For anyone in the UK thinking about buying gear from a European HH, here is a brief run-down of the process, so you know what to expect.
It took about 8 days from us agreeing, to me receiving the 502. I was on a business trip, so it took me a couple of days to get to my bank to initiate the payment. British high street banks can make a direct payment in Euros from a UK account to a European bank account. This is a Single Euro Area Credit Transfer - which costs GBP 15 (Barclays) or GBP 20 (Lloyds TSB). The process is very similar to a UK Faster Payment. You will need the IBAN and the recipient's name. Payment is received in the Euro Area account by close of business on the next day. Allow for a weekend. Shipment by DHL pickup in Germany on Monday, and arrived here in the UK at my home around 07:25 Wed.
Simple and straightforward.
